South Lake Tahoe is a great town for skiing. However, Atlanta is not a skiing destination.

South Lake Tahoe draws a large crowd in the winter for its impressive snow skiing opportunities. There are three ski resorts in the area. Heavenly Mountain Resort is the largest, but if you're looking for something smaller, head to Kirkwood, which is tucked away and less well known. There's also Sierra-at-Tahoe Resort, which is popular with groups and families because it caters to a range of skill levels.

Atlanta is an amazing city to visit for its sights and museums. However, South Lake Tahoe is not a good town for its museums and history.

The museums, monuments, and landmarks in Atlanta are among the most recognizable in the world. The museums range in topic from history to science and art. The country's largest aquarium, the Georgia Aquarium, is in Atlanta as well. It's home to whale sharks, stingrays, and a diversity of marine life. Other museums around town include the Atlanta History Center, the Fernbank Museum of Natural History, the High Museum of Art, the World of Coca Cola, the David J. Sencer CDC Museum, and the Delta Flight Museum. There are also many monuments and sites including the Martin Luther King Jr. National Historic Site.

While most people don't head to South Lake Tahoe specifically for the museums and attractions, it does offer a few options. Most people spend their time exploring the area's nature, but you can also stop by Tallac Historic Site or the Lake Tahoe Historical Society Museum.

Atlanta is a well-known place for its local cuisine and restaurants. Also, South Lake Tahoe is not as famous, but is still a good town to visit for its restaurants.

Eating is part of the travel experience when you visit Atlanta. It's a huge city with a wide selection of restaurants including international, local, and classic southern styles. Fried chicken, biscuits, diner food, and barbecue are all popular. For a classic southern breakfast check out The OK Cafe and for a quintessential Atlanta experience go to The Varsity.

South Lake Tahoe is becoming an appealing option for foodies. While most resorts have their own restaurants, there are a number of options around town that specialize in "alpine comfort cuisine", which is worth sampling. You'll also find plenty of cafes that serve up a hearty breakfast - the perfect way to start an active day.

South Lake Tahoe is terrific for its evening party scene. Also, Atlanta is not as popular, but is still a nice city for nightlife.

South Lake Tahoe is a must-see party destination. The resort town has plenty of nightclubs, bars, and music venues. There are outdoor options when the weather is warm as well as indoor settings for cooler weather. You'll also find casinos and live shows.

Atlanta offers plenty to do in the evening. The nightlife scene is diverse with trendy bars, dance clubs, and huge music halls. There are a number of neighborhoods that each have their own atmosphere. For some of the best nightlife check out the upscale bars in Buckhead, the music venues in Midtown, the hipster vibe in Edgewood, or the laid-back atmosphere in Virginia Highland.

Atlanta is an amazing city to visit for its shopping opportunities. Also, South Lake Tahoe is not as famous, but is still a good town to visit for its shopping areas.

The abundance of shops in Atlanta make it a world-class shopping destination. There are a number of great shopping districts around town. Atlantic Station is popular with a movie theater and ice skating. Buckhead has boutique and local vendors and Lenox Square has a large shopping mall.

South Lake Tahoe has a variety of shopping areas worth visiting. Most of the shopping involves retailers selling ski gear or outdoor equipment. There are also clothing shops, gift stores, and some art galleries.

Is Atlanta or South Lake Tahoe Better for Public Transit? Which Is Easier to Get Around Without a Car?

Atlanta
South Lake Tahoe

Atlanta and South Lake Tahoe both offer decent public transit to get you around.

Public transit is mostly limited in Atlanta. For such a large city, the public transportation system is very limited. MARTA is the main transit authority and there are a few subway lines that cross the city as well as bus routes running around town.

Public transit is generally limited in South Lake Tahoe. While there are some shuttles and buses, if you really want to explore the area, you'll need your own car.

Which place is cheaper, South Lake Tahoe or Atlanta?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Atlanta is $173, while the average daily cost in South Lake Tahoe is $118.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ination.
